-
shell正则元字符查看全部
-
sed '2d' test.txt #删除第二行 sed '2,4d' test.txt #删除第二到第四行 sed '2a input content' test.txt #在第二行后追加input content sed '2i input content' test.txt #在第二行前插入input content sed '2c input content' test.txt #将第二行替换为input content(替换一整行) 各个动作都可以加上行号范围 /g是指在指定范围内有多个旧字符串,就替换掉所有的,如果没有/g,就只替换第一个旧字符串 多个动作之间可用“;”隔开查看全部
-
二、字符截取命令 1、grep是行提取命令 2、cut是列提取命令 cut[选项] 文件名 -f 列号:提取第几列,提取多个列时,之间用“,”隔开 -d 分隔符:按照指定分隔符分割整个列,默认使用制表符tab 当列之间有较为明确的分隔符可以使用时,可以使用cut,但是使用像空格这类的分隔符时,cut就无法使用了。查看全部
-
提取时间和IP的正则表达式查看全部
-
基础正则表达式查看全部
-
通配符匹配文件名称 正则表达式用来在文件中匹配符合条件的字符串查看全部
-
通配符是完全匹配 正则是包含匹配查看全部
-
通配符查看全部
-
要点:1.正则匹配的是文件中的数据,通配符用来匹配文件名;2.正则是包含匹配,通配符是完全匹配;3.操作字符串的命令参数一般用正则,操作文件名的命令参数只能用通配符。查看全部
-
awk begin查看全部
-
awk print查看全部
-
awk查看全部
-
printf输出类型查看全部
-
printf查看全部
-
基础正则表达式查看全部
举报
0/150
提交
取消